Nigerian multi-instrumentalist and political activist Fela Kuti is regarded as the progenitor of the Afrobeat genre- a combination of West African music with American funk and jazz fueled by political activism that has since found widespread popularity worldwide and within the contemporary music industry. Today, his sons, Femi Kuti and Seun Kuti, uphold his iconic legacy while making their own unique marks in the genre and propelling the influence of contemporary African music worldwide. This week, to celebrate World Children's Day, we explore the lives and enduring impact of the pioneering Afrobeat family.
